What structure normally initiates each electrical impulse that triggers a heartbeat?
- The atrioventricular (AV) node
- The bundle of His
- The sinoatrial (SA) node
- The Purkinje fibers
Why C? And why not the others?
Correct answer: C. The sinoatrial (SA) node
The sinoatrial node, a small patch of specialized, spontaneously firing cells in the wall of the right atrium near where the vena cava enters, generates the electrical impulse that starts every normal heartbeat, earning it the nickname the heart's natural pacemaker; the autonomic nervous system adjusts how fast it fires but does not itself originate the signal. The atrioventricular node's job comes right after: it receives that signal from the atria and briefly delays it, giving the atria time to finish contracting before the ventricles are triggered, but it does not start the impulse itself. The bundle of His and the Purkinje fibers sit further downstream still, carrying the already-initiated signal down the septum and out through the ventricular walls so the lower chambers contract in a coordinated wave, relay structures rather than the impulse's point of origin.
